DescriptionIn the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: HID: roccat: free buffered reports when destroying device roccat_report_event() duplicates each report with kmemdup() and stores the allocation in a circular-buffer slot. The allocation is released only when that slot is reused. The device destruction paths free struct roccat_device without releasing reports still stored in cbuf[]. This makes those allocations unreachable and leaks up to ROCCAT_CBUF_SIZE report buffers per device. Add a small destructor that frees every buffered report before freeing the device, and use it in both paths that can destroy a registered device.
